"Tonight (Best You Ever Had)" is a song by American singer-songwriter John Legend featuring American rapper Ludacris. Written alongside Miguel and production group Phatboiz, the song served as the lead single from the soundtrack to the 2012 American romantic comedy film Think Like a Man. "Tonight (Best You Ever Had)" peaked at number 12 on the US Billboard Hot R&B/Hip-Hop Songs and reached the lower half of the US Billboard Hot 100. It reached platinum status in the United States and earned a Grammy Award nomination for Best Rap/Sung Performance.
